Registering SNMP Traps
Registering an
Application
234
1 Log on as an administrator.
2 Make sure that you are viewing the physical library. From the View
menu, click the name of the physical library.
3 Click Setup > Notifications > Trap Registration. The Trap
Registration dialog box appears.
4 In the Host/IP text box, type the iPv4 or iPv6 address or host name
of the host client running of the external application.
5 In the Port text box, type the number of the User Datagram Protocol
(UDP) port that you want to associate with the IP address or host
name.
6 Click Create.
The host application's IP address or name and UDP port number
appear in the table to indicate that the application is registered to
receive SNMP traps from the library.
